Fayetteville library gets state grant to build lab and business center
Syracuse.com
By Elizabeth Doran / The Post-Standard The Fayetteville Free Library is receiving more than $250000 in a state grant to build a Fab Lab and Business Center. The funds, which come from a New York State Library Construction Grant, were announced by Sen.

Regional Access links natural New York state products with consumers across ...
Syracuse.com (blog)
Regional Access, on Route 96 between Ithaca and Trumansburg, stocks and distributes specialty and natural foods from more than 100 producers in New York. Every week, a small fleet of 11 trucks delivers up to 3400 products to more than 250 restaurants, ...
